In the rapidly expanding ecosystem of web development, picking the right tools and frameworks is necessary for building robust and efficient applications.
Among the myriad of options available, the combination of Laravel and Vue.js has emerged as a powerful duo, offering developers an ideal synergy for crafting modern web applications.
In this blog, we’ll explore the strengths of each and delve into how they seamlessly integrate to provide an exceptional development experience.
Laravel is a well-regarded PHP framework that has earned widespread acclaim for its elegant syntax, developer-friendly features, and robust performance.
It streamlines intricate tasks like routing, caching, and authentication, empowering developers to concentrate on the core logic of their applications.
The framework adheres to the Model-View-Controller (MVC) architecture, fostering a clean and organised codebase.
Engaging in Laravel development with a skilled Laravel developer ensures the utilization of these advantages for efficient and effective application creation.
In the global landscape of 2023, more than 118,096 companies have embraced Laravel as their preferred programming framework tool.
Laravel offers the following advantages:
On the client side, Vue.js has emerged as a progressive JavaScript framework that excels in building user interfaces.
Its simplicity, reactivity system, and ease of integration make it a favorite among developers. Vue.js is designed to be incrementally adoptable, meaning it can be easily integrated into existing projects without the need for a full rewrite.
Vue.js is employed on 6.85% of the world’s top 1 million websites because of the following advantages:
A combination of Laravel and vue.js has the following advantages:
The combination of Vue.js and Laravel enables simple two-way data binding. The seamless integration between Laravel’s Eloquent ORM and Vue.js’s reactivity ensures instantaneous synchronization between the front end interface and the back end data.
This improves web applications’ real-time responsiveness and interactivity. This makes it an excellent choice when working with Laravel.
For creating Android apps, the combination of Laravel and Vue.js works perfectly. This combination provides an adaptable base that lets developers design feature-rich, scalable apps that meet the ever-changing requirements of Android platforms.
Take advantage of vibrant and helpful communities for Laravel and Vue.js. A plethora of packages, tutorials, and extensive documentation make development and troubleshooting easy and encourage developers to work together to solve problems and share knowledge.
Laravel’s robust backend capabilities enable the creation of an efficient e-commerce platform with real-time product availability, making it an ideal choice for dynamic solutions, particularly in the Android application development services field.
The shopping cart, checkout process, and product catalog are all dynamically provided by Vue.js on the front end, guaranteeing that users see real-time updates when adding items or changing prices, thus improving the overall shopping experience.
Larvel is a RESTful API that can be used to create a project management system with tasks, data storage, and user authentication. Vue.js can create interactive components for task lists, project schedules, and teamwork.
Vue.js’s responsiveness ensures real-time teamwork by enabling changes made by one team member to be reflected for others.
In summary
Laravel and Vue.js are powerful web development tools for building modern, scalable, and feature-rich applications.
Their combination creates an efficient environment for developers, enabling exceptional user experiences.
These versatile and scalable frameworks are well-positioned for future innovations and shaping the digital landscape.